Home | History | Annotate | Download | only in gold

Lines Matching full:abiflags_

1594       pdr_shndx_(-1U), attributes_section_data_(NULL), abiflags_(NULL),
1864 { return this->abiflags_; }
1948 Mips_abiflags<big_endian>* abiflags_;
2831 : Output_section_data(24, 8, true), abiflags_(abiflags)
2844 const Mips_abiflags<big_endian>& abiflags_;
3297 mips_stubs_(NULL), attributes_section_data_(NULL), abiflags_(NULL),
4202 Mips_abiflags<big_endian>* abiflags_;
6795 gold_assert(this->abiflags_ == NULL);
6801 this->abiflags_ = new Mips_abiflags<big_endian>();
6803 this->abiflags_->version =
6805 if (this->abiflags_->version != 0)
6810 this->abiflags_->version);
6813 this->abiflags_->isa_level =
6815 this->abiflags_->isa_rev =
6817 this->abiflags_->gpr_size =
6819 this->abiflags_->cpr1_size =
6821 this->abiflags_->cpr2_size =
6823 this->abiflags_->fp_abi =
6825 this->abiflags_->isa_ext =
6827 this->abiflags_->ases =
6829 this->abiflags_->flags1 =
6831 this->abiflags_->flags2 =
8151 elfcpp::Swap<16, big_endian>::writeval(view, this->abiflags_.version);
8152 elfcpp::Swap<8, big_endian>::writeval(view + 2, this->abiflags_.isa_level);
8153 elfcpp::Swap<8, big_endian>::writeval(view + 3, this->abiflags_.isa_rev);
8154 elfcpp::Swap<8, big_endian>::writeval(view + 4, this->abiflags_.gpr_size);
8155 elfcpp::Swap<8, big_endian>::writeval(view + 5, this->abiflags_.cpr1_size);
8156 elfcpp::Swap<8, big_endian>::writeval(view + 6, this->abiflags_.cpr2_size);
8157 elfcpp::Swap<8, big_endian>::writeval(view + 7, this->abiflags_.fp_abi);
8158 elfcpp::Swap<32, big_endian>::writeval(view + 8, this->abiflags_.isa_ext);
8159 elfcpp::Swap<32, big_endian>::writeval(view + 12, this->abiflags_.ases);
8160 elfcpp::Swap<32, big_endian>::writeval(view + 16, this->abiflags_.flags1);
8161 elfcpp::Swap<32, big_endian>::writeval(view + 20, this->abiflags_.flags2);
9187 out_attr[elfcpp::Tag_GNU_MIPS_ABI_FP].set_int_value(this->abiflags_->fp_abi);
9201 if (this->abiflags_ == NULL)
9203 this->abiflags_ = new Mips_abiflags<big_endian>(*in_abiflags);
9207 this->abiflags_->fp_abi = this->select_fp_abi(name, in_abiflags->fp_abi,
9208 this->abiflags_->fp_abi);
9211 this->abiflags_->isa_level = std::max(this->abiflags_->isa_level,
9213 this->abiflags_->isa_rev = std::max(this->abiflags_->isa_rev,
9215 this->abiflags_->gpr_size = std::max(this->abiflags_->gpr_size,
9217 this->abiflags_->cpr1_size = std::max(this->abiflags_->cpr1_size,
9219 this->abiflags_->cpr2_size = std::max(this->abiflags_->cpr2_size,
9221 this->abiflags_->ases |= in_abiflags->ases;
9222 this->abiflags_->flags1 |= in_abiflags->flags1;
9323 this->update_abiflags_isa(name, merged_flags, this->abiflags_);
9442 if (this->abiflags_ != NULL
9443 && (this->abiflags_->fp_abi == elfcpp::Val_GNU_MIPS_ABI_FP_64
9444 || this->abiflags_->fp_abi == elfcpp::Val_GNU_MIPS_ABI_FP_64A))
9617 new Mips_output_section_abiflags<size, big_endian>(*this->abiflags_);